The Formation Mechanism and Countermeasures of Overseas Compliance Risks in Export Control
The characteristics of overseas compliance risks are reflected in the diversity of applicable laws,the heterogeneity of affected groups,and the long-term nature of impacts.The formation mechanisms include five primary triggers:violations of territorial jurisdiction,item jurisdiction,user jurisdiction,usage jurisdiction,and the Foreign Direct Product rule(FDP).To address compliance risks arising from fair export controls,enterprises must to establish robust internal compliance management systems and enhance their compliance capabilities.For compliance risks caused by unfair export controls,enterprises should seek state protection and resolutely safeguard their legitimate rights and interests abroad.
